Publisher's summary

Welcome to the challenge. You're an absolute nobody here - nothing; a zero; a useless lump of meat filled with bones. You're but a delicious morsel for your antagonists and those who got lucky at the start. The only goal you can have in your miserable existence is to kick the bucket as soon as possible.
